Warm-up and Stretching Techniques
To stop injuries during fighting styles training, it's vital to appropriately heat up your body and execute reliable stretching methods.
Prior to diving right into extreme exercise, take a few minutes to get your blood moving and muscle mass warmed up. Start with some light cardio workouts like jogging in position or jumping jacks. This will increase your heart price and prepare your body for the upcoming training session.
Next off, focus on vibrant stretching to boost adaptability and variety of activity. Execute activities like leg swings, arm circles, and upper body twists. Dynamic extending helps to activate your muscle mass and stops them from getting stressed during training. Appropriate Method and Kind
After heating up and stretching, it's vital to focus on correct method and type in order to protect against injuries throughout martial arts training.
Taking note of your method and form can make a considerable difference in decreasing the threat of injury. Right here are 5 bottom lines to remember:
- Keep a solid and steady stance, dispersing your weight uniformly.
- Keep your core engaged and your body straightened to make certain correct balance and stability.
- Execute methods with precision and control, avoiding unnecessary stress on your muscular tissues and joints.
- Concentrate on correct breathing strategies to enhance endurance and stop muscular tissue tension.
- Listen to your body and stay clear of pushing beyond your restrictions, slowly increasing intensity and trouble gradually.
Healing and Relax Approaches
Taking sufficient time for healing and rest is vital in keeping a healthy and balanced and injury-free martial arts training routine. After intense training sessions, your body needs time to fix and recoup. It's throughout this duration that your muscle mass reconstruct and strengthen, enabling you to enhance your performance gradually.
See to it to incorporate day of rest into your training routine to provide your body the moment it needs to recover.
